DeeAnn Leone (Auten) Redding, age 53, of Coldwater, Michigan ( formerly of Pleasant Lake Indiana) passed away Sunday April 16, 2023. DeeAnn was born August 04, 1969 in Coldwater, MI to Richard & Margaret (Fisher) Auten.

DeeAnn leaves behind her siblings; Richard O (Beth) Auten of Coldwater, MI, Jennifer V (Jeffrey) Ziems of Coldwater, MI; step children Jaden and Olivia Redding.

She is preceded in death by her parents and grandparents and leaves behind her 3 golden retrievers; Cashew, Keylee, and Ringo.

DeeAnn graduated from Coldwater High School in 1987. She was a huge NASCAR fan and loved watching dirt track racing too. One of her favorite things to do was to watch the truck pulls at Branch County Fairgrounds.

Cremation has taken place and no formal services will be held at this time.

A Celebration of Life will be held at a later date.

In lieu of flowers the family is asking for donations to be made to The Humane Society.
